Understanding Realtek Audio Drivers:

Realtek audio drivers are software components that act as the bridge between your computer's hardware and the operating system. By interpreting commands from the OS, they facilitate the seamless transmission of audio signals to your speakers or headphones. These drivers play a pivotal role in ensuring that your audio experience is glitch-free, immersive, and tailored to your preferences.

Installation and Configuration:

Installing and configuring Realtek audio drivers is a straightforward process:

  1. Download the drivers: Visit the Realtek website to download the latest drivers compatible with your device.
  2. Run the installer: Once downloaded, run the installer and follow the on-screen instructions.
  3. Restart your computer: After the installation is complete, restart your computer for the changes to take effect.
  4. Configure your settings: Open the Realtek Audio Control Panel from your taskbar or start menu to customize your audio settings.

Troubleshooting Common Issues:

If you encounter any issues with your Realtek audio drivers, try the following troubleshooting steps:

Check your connections: Ensure that your speakers or headphones are properly connected to the audio jack.
Restart your audio driver: Open the Device Manager, locate your audio driver, right-click and select "Disable." Then, right-click again and select "Enable."
Reinstall your audio driver: Uninstall the existing driver and reinstall the latest version from the Realtek website.
Seek professional help: If the issue persists, contact the Realtek support team or a qualified computer technician.

FAQs:

1. Are Realtek audio drivers free?

Yes, Realtek audio drivers are free to download from the Realtek website.

2. How do I know if my Realtek audio drivers are up to date?

Open the Device Manager, locate your audio driver, and check the version number. Compare it to the latest version available on the Realtek website.
